"California investigates Florida's role in migrant arrivals in Sacramento"

A second plane carrying about 20 Latin American migrants, mainly from Venezuela, arrived in Sacramento on Monday, three days after the first planeload arrived. The authorities in California said those migrants carried papers indicating that their travel had been “administered by the Florida Division of Emergency Management” and its contractor, Vertol Systems Company, which is based in Florida. California officials accused Vertol of transporting the group under a false promise of jobs if the migrants agreed to be taken to California. Governor Gavin Newsom and the state’s attorney general, Rob Bonta, have said they believed Governor Ron DeSantis of Florida, a Republican running for president, had arranged for the flight on Friday.
